Micro-sucks
Topic
Micro-sucks is a behavioral protocol popularized by neurobiologist Andrew Huberman that involves deliberately engaging in small, unpleasant, or undesirable tasks to build willpower and mental tenacity. According to neuroscience, consistently performing these friction-inducing activities stimulates and increases the size of the anterior midcingulate cortex (aMCC), a brain region associated with self-discipline and resilience.
